Almonds are whole tree nuts used raw, roasted, or chopped in baking, salads, and snacking. One metric cup (250 ml) of whole almonds weighs around 143 grams or 5.04 ounces. When a recipe calls for almonds in cups but you are weighing from a bag, converting by weight keeps the nut count right for cakes, granola, and toppings.

Whole almonds pack loosely, so a scooped cup can swing by several grams. Weighing in grams gives a steadier amount than a cup measure across bakes and trail mixes.

Slivered almonds are whole almonds cut into thin strips, so they pack lighter per cup (108 g vs 143 g). Use slivered for even toasting and a neat finish on cakes and salads, whole almonds where you want bite and crunch. Convert by weight, not cups. See our Slivered Almonds converter.

Almond meal is whole almonds ground to a coarse flour, so it weighs much less per cup (100 g vs 143 g). You cannot swap whole almonds straight into a batter; grind them first, or weigh out almond meal when a recipe needs the ground form. See our Almond Meal converter.

Almond flour is blanched almonds milled fine and pale, weighing far less per cup (96 g vs 143 g). Whole almonds are not a direct swap; blitz them to a flour, or weigh almond flour when a recipe calls for the ground, skinless form. See our Almond Flour converter.

Almond butter is whole almonds ground into a smooth, oily paste, much denser per cup (256 g vs 143 g). For a spread or sauce, blend whole almonds with a little oil, or weigh out almond butter rather than swapping by volume. See our Almond Butter converter.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is 1 cup of almonds in grams?
1 cup of almonds in grams is 143 grams. The ratio is fixed, so 2 cups is 286 grams and half a cup is 71.5 grams. Weighing almonds by the cup is the most common way to measure it for baking. How many cups is 100 grams of almonds?
100 grams of almonds is 0.7 cups. The conversion scales in a straight line, so 200 grams is 1.4 cups and 50 grams is 0.35 cups. Grams to cups helps when a recipe gives a weight but you measure with cups. See the full grams to cups chart for almonds for more amounts. 100g almonds to cups
